A triangle has interior angles equal to 55, 70 and x. What is the value of X?
A:180
B:125
C:55
D:10

Respuesta :

somesweetangel somesweetangel
  • 03-07-2015


The answer is C. 55

You get your answer by adding together the degrees of the angles you know 55+70

That equals 125 degrees and subtract that from 180 degrees

180-125= 55
